windows-phone-7 - 当我将 InputScope 设置为搜索时,如何判断何时单击了 "search"按钮?

标签 windows-phone-7 sip windows-phone

适用于 Windows Phone。当我将 InputScope 设置为在 TextBox 上搜索时,如何知道何时单击了“搜索”按钮?有事件吗?

最佳答案

InputScope 设置为“Search”时,“search”按钮只是一个重新设计的“enter”按钮。所以,假设:

<TextBox InputScope="Search" KeyDown="SearchBox_KeyDown" />

“搜索”按钮被按下(在 SIP 上)可以通过以下方式检测到:

private void SearchBox_KeyDown(object sender, KeyEventArgs e)
{
    if (e.Key == Key.Enter)
    {
        // Do search...
    }
}

关于windows-phone-7 - 当我将 InputScope 设置为搜索时,如何判断何时单击了 "search"按钮?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/4665869/

相关文章:

c - 用 C 编写一个简单的 voip 应用程序

c# - 不足以阻止在 WP7 ListBox 中滚动

database - Kamailio:如何根据 IP 负载平衡多个 Asterisk 服务器之间的调用

windows-phone-7 - 如何在 Windows Phone 7 上使用 rsa 库?

javascript - Twilio 到 OnSip 应用程序错误 : Dial->Sip: SIP URI DNS does not resolve or resolves to an non-public IP address

c# - Windows Phone 8 上存在哪些 URI 协议(protocol)?

windows-phone - Caliburn 微导航服务导致空引用异常

c# - 从 ObservableCollection<List> 中删除由 DateTime 确定的列表项

c# - Metro App 如何禁用 Gridview 滚动

gesture-recognition - Windows Phone 7.5 Mango 上的音乐识别